This aligns with mid-July climatology of 21–22°C but reflects cooler maritime air advection rather than any developing heat dome or subsidence. Key differentiators between the closely matched 18°C, 19°C, and 20°C outcomes include the precise timing and extent of cloud breaks, which control solar insolation, versus sustained northwest winds that enhance mixing and evaporative cooling. With resolution just 48 hours away, the next model runs and observational updates on boundary-layer conditions will determine whether modest clearing allows a brief spike toward 20°C or persistent cover caps the maximum closer to 18°C.
